Sources said on Monday that the 20 acres Open Air Jail premises in Ondipudur area may be handed over to the Department of Youth Welfare and Sports Development for constructing the World-Class Cricket Stadium in Coimbatore, which was proposed by Industries Minister TRB Raja and promised by Chief Minister MK Stalin as a poll-promise in March, this year.

 

The Tahsildar of Coimbatore - South has written to the Assistant Commissioner of Coimbatore Corporation - East Zone to transfer the 20.72 acres land of the Open Prison Ground to the Sports Development Department.

 

During the last visit of TN Sports Minister Udhayanidhi Stalin to the city, he paid a visit to the Open Air Jail premises, enquiring whether it will be a viable site for the proposed project. Coimbatore District Collector Kranthi Kumar, Minister-in-charge of Coimbatore, Muthusamy and DMK MP A.Raja accompanied him.

 

Earlier, 3 sites were pitched as a possible venue for the project; land near Bharathiar University, L&T Bypass and Ondipudur. Minister Udhayanidhi's visit to the Open Air Jail led many to assume that the project could come up there. That belief has now become stronger.
